The Importance of Zinc-Plated Washers in Manufacturing and Construction


In the world of manufacturing and construction, the smallest components often play a crucial role in the structural integrity and functionality of a project. One such overlooked yet vital component is the washer, specifically zinc-plated washers. These small discs, typically made from metal with a hole in the center, are essential for distributing load, reducing friction, and preventing damage to surfaces. What are Zinc-Plated Washers?


Zinc-plated washers are metal washers that have undergone a coating process where a thin layer of zinc is applied to the surface. This protective layer is crucial as it enhances corrosion resistance, making these washers suitable for outdoor and indoor applications alike. The zinc coating acts as a barrier between the metal and environmental factors like moisture and oxygen, which can cause rust and degradation over time.


Manufacturing Process


The production of zinc-plated washers starts with selecting the base metal, usually steel, due to its strength and durability. The manufacturing process typically involves several steps


1. Stamping or Cutting The first step involves stamping or cutting the metal sheet into circular shapes, which will form the washers.


2. Finishing Once the washers are cut, they undergo a finishing process to ensure a smooth surface. This step is crucial as it affects the quality of the zinc plating.


3. Zinc Plating The finished washers are then subjected to a zinc plating process, commonly achieved through electroplating. In this process, the washers are submerged in a solution of zinc salts and an electric current is passed through the solution, causing zinc to deposit onto the surface of the washers.


4. Quality Control Manufacturers conduct rigorous quality control checks to ensure that the zinc plating is even and adheres well to the base metal. This step is essential for ensuring the longevity and effectiveness of the washers in their intended applications.


5. Packaging and Distribution Finally, the washers are packaged and distributed to various industries, including automotive, construction, and manufacturing.

Applications of Zinc-Plated Washers


Zinc-plated washers are versatile and find applications across various sectors. In construction, they are used to secure beams, hold structures together, and provide support under bolts and nuts. In the automotive industry, they serve functions from securing components to providing cushioning between parts to reduce vibration. Additionally, they are commonly found in household appliances, furniture assembly, and machinery.
